Abstract
The invention discloses a method for synthesizing arbutin by utilizing h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is to convert hydroquinone. In the method, the arbutin is synthesized by cultivating the h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is and converting hydroquinone by cells of the h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is. The content of the arbutin in the converted h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is can reach 4 to 6 percent. The conversion rate of the hydroquinone can reach 50 to 60 percent. The method has the characteristics of low pollution, few by-products and the like. A novel technology and a novel approach are provided for the production of the arbutin.

Background technology
Arbutin is a kind of composition that comes from Ericaceae manzanita uva ursi.Research shows that arbutin has restraint of tyrosinase activity, antibechic, diuresis, the biological activity such as antibacterial.Arbutin can be combined with tyrosine oxidase effectively, makes melanic synthetic minimizing, thereby reduces pigment deposition in skin, is to be usually used in the main raw material in skin-lightening cosmetic both at home and abroad at present, and domestic and international market demand is very huge.The production of arbutin is mainly by chemosynthesis at present, but chemosynthesis needs 4~6 steps to react, and synthetic cost is high, pollution is large, by product is many.
Bio-transformation refers to by culturing micro-organisms, vegetable cell, plant tissue, utilizes enzyme in its body to carry out structural modification to external source substrate and obtains a kind of technology of valuable product.This technology, compared with chemosynthesis, has the advantages such as nontoxic, pollution-free, less energy-consumption, high-level efficiency, highly selective.

The method of described cultivation root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root is:
1) root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root is inoculated in root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ed culture medium to lucifuge concussion under 100~150r/min with 4-5g/L and cultivates 18~20 days to obtain root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ed, 25~28 DEG C of the temperature of cultivating, root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ed culture medium is the modified MS medium of adding 40-50g/L sucrose;
2) root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ed being inoculated in substratum to lucifuge concussion under 100~150r/min with 4-5g/L cultivates 20~30 days, the temperature of cultivating is 25~28 DEG C, and substratum is the modified MS medium of adding 30-60g/L sucrose, glucose or its mixture and 0.4mmol/L phenylalanine.Add the effect of a certain amount of sucrose, glucose and 0.4mmol/L phenylalanine to be to promote root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root Fast Growth, improved the ability of the synthetic arbutin of h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is, be conducive to save production cost, increase economic efficiency.
The time of described conversion is 30~40h, and temperature when conversion is 20~28 DEG C.
Described Resorcinol dissolves with the aqueous ethanolic solution of volume fraction 70% before adding, and dissolving ratio is that every 1-5mL aqueous ethanolic solution dissolves 20mg Resorcinol.The effect of aqueous ethanolic solution is to reduce the probability of root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root microbiological contamination in the process that adds Resorcinol, avoids microbiological contamination in h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is Resorcinol process.
The add-on of described Resorcinol is to add 15~25mg in the nutrient solution of every 100mL root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root.In the time that the add-on of every 100mL nutrient solution exceedes 25mg, Resorcinol suppresses the growth of root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root.
Compared with existing arbutin production technology, the present invention has following useful technique effect:
1. compared with chemical synthesis, production technique of the present invention is easy, and the transformation efficiency of substrate reaches 50~60%, has the advantages such as low pollution, by product are few; 2. with compared with plant extraction process, arbutin is with short production cycle, and condition is controlled, is not subject to seasonal restrictions; 3. the present invention utilizes the glucosides transformation function of root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root, can be used as the bio-reactor of new product, for arbutin synthetic provides a kind of new way, also for development of new medicinal material provides new way and new approaches.

Embodiment 2
1) root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root is inoculated in root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ed culture medium with 5g/L, 28 DEG C, 100r/min, lucifuge is cultivated 20 days; Described root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ed culture medium is the MS substratum that adds the improvement of 40g/L sucrose;
2) by through step 1) the fresh and tender root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root seed cultivated 20 days is inoculated in substratum with 5g/L, and 28 DEG C, 100r/min, lucifuge is cultivated 20 days; Described substratum is the modified MS medium of adding 50g/L sucrose and 10g/L glucose and 0.4mmol/L phenylalanine; Described modified MS medium adopts as the formula of embodiment 1;
3) Resorcinol is dissolved in the aqueous ethanolic solution of volume fraction 70%, dissolving ratio is that every 2mL aqueous ethanolic solution dissolves 20mg, under aseptic condition, join through step 2) cultivate after root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root nutrient solution in, utilize hairy roots of scutellaria baicalensis 40h, temperature when conversion is 28 DEG C; Transform and carry out under lucifuge condition, the add-on of described Resorcinol is 20mg/100mL nutrient solution;
4) in HPLC mensuration hairly root, the content of arbutin is 4.71%, and the transformation efficiency of Resorcinol is 56.13%.Compared with embodiment 1, by hairly root cultivation stage substratum in add glucose and phenylalanine, improved the transformation efficiency of Resorcinol.

HPLC measures the method for arbutin in root of large-flowered skullcap hairly root: the hairly root after results transform, and 80 DEG C of oven dry, 95% ethanol, with 1: 100 solid-liquid ratio, refluxing extraction 5h; HPLC method is measured the condition determination of arbutin content in hairly root: waters-2487, Symmetry-C
18(250mm × 4.6mm, 5 μ m), flow velocity 0.8mL/min, moving phase: V
methyl alcohol: V
water=15: 85, detect wavelength: 287nm.
